Overview

 

POSITION SUMMARY:

The Certified Medical Assistant will perform delegated clinical and administrative duties consistent with Medical Assistant program education, training, and experience. May work in both the clinical and front office functions of the practice providing clerical support, assisting in the delivery of health care and patient care support activities at the direction of the physician/provider. The incumbent performs the duties described below in accordance with the specific needs of the practice. If working in the Rural Health Clinic setting, will be required to have BLS through the American Heart Association.


Qualifications

 

RE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S:

Education:

High School Diploma or GED

 

AND Certificate of completion or Diploma from a medical assistant program including internship/ externship applied learning.

  

OR Education equivalency: at least 6 months experience in Certified Medical Assistant role OR proof of completion of on-the-job training/education program for certified medical assisting in another healthcare organization.

 

Licensure/ Certification: CMA-Certified Medical Assistant Current certification by one the following approved certifying agencies:

  • American Association of Medical Assistants (AAMA), earning CMA credential.
  • American Medical Technologists (AMT), earning RMA credential.
  • National Center for Competency Testing (NCCT), earning NCMA credential.
  • National HealthCare Association (NHA), earning CCMA credential.
  • National Association for Health Professionals (NAHP) .
  • American Allied Health (AAH).

 

Other Skills/ Knowledge: Excellent interpersonal and communication skills. Solid computer skills, including proficiency with Microsoft software.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to be detail oriented.

 

P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S:

 

Experience: Previous experience as a medical office assistant or CNA or equivalent, previous experience with an electronic health record, phlebotomy.

 

Licensure/ Certification: If working in the Rural Health Clinic setting, will be required to have BLS through the American Heart Association.
